Mike at The Oblivious Investor has eleven tips for selecting mutual funds. Using his tips and a little research, you’ll see why it’s wise to invest in index mutual funds. Those tips will also give you an informed mindset when you approach investing so you won’t be caught up in all the financial noise the media throws at us every day.
